At the turn of the 20th century, Jewish women on the Lower East Side struggled to support their families by keeping house in crowded, dark, and unsanitary tenement apartments, and by working long hours in factories and sweatshops. Confronted with low wages and unsafe working conditions, as well as rising costs of food and rent, many women responded by joining unions, organizing pickets, and even rioting in the streets.
